Default fass fuel system

does anyone know if you can get diffrent harnesses for a fass 150 to make it plug and play for all manufacturers because i found a great deal on a system buyt it was off a 98-02 cummins but going on to a 00' powerstroke so i need to see if the pigtails are interchangeable or will i have to send it to fass to get it changed?

It is not the correct pump for your truck. It is a low pressure lift pump for a cummins which puts out about 13-15psi. Your PSI requires 55-70psi.

Dont get it, waste.
